Nicole Shanahan Early Life and Education
Nicole Shanahan was born in 1985 in the United States and grew up in California. She earned a bachelor's degree from the University of Puget Sound and later a Juris Doctor from Santa Clara University School of Law, where she focused on technology law and intellectual property. She is the founder of Bia-Echo, a private foundation focused on reproductive longevity and sustainability, and she has been publicly linked to major tech and finance circles through her legal work and investments.
Before founding Bia-Echo, Shanahan worked as an attorney at several law firms and later launched her own practice, representing clients in complex commercial and intellectual property matters. She has cited personal experiences with fertility challenges as a driver for her philanthropic focus, and Bia-Echo has funded research into in vitro gametogenesis and related fields. She also serves on advisory boards and has been invited to speak at forums on innovation, women's health, and long-term investing.
Career, Investments, and Net Worth
Nicole Shanahan's net worth is primarily tied to her role as the founder and president of Bia-Echo, her legal career, and her early investments in private technology companies. She has been involved in venture and growth-stage deals, with a focus on deep tech, biotech, and sustainability. While her exact net worth is not publicly disclosed, Forbes and other outlets have listed her among high-net-worth individuals connected to the technology and finance sectors.
Shanahan has also been active in family office-style investing, backing companies in artificial intelligence, space, and advanced materials. Her investment portfolio includes stakes in firms working on longevity, energy storage, and AI infrastructure. She has served on advisory and board roles at several startups, and her investment activity has been reported in financial media as part of a broader trend of tech-connected philanthropists deploying capital into early-stage science and technology ventures.
Personal Life and Public Profile
Marriage to Sergey Brin and Family
Nicole Shanahan married Sergey Brin, co-founder of Alphabet and Google, in 2018. They have two children together and have made joint philanthropic commitments through Bia-Echo and other charitable vehicles. The couple separated in late 2022, and their divorce was finalized in 2023. During the marriage, Shanahan continued to lead Bia-Echo and maintain her independent investment and legal work.
Shanahan has maintained a relatively low public profile compared to other high-profile spouses in the tech industry, focusing her public appearances on Bia-Echo initiatives, science funding, and policy discussions around reproductive health. She has spoken at events hosted by organizations connected to longevity research, AI ethics, and global health. Her public profile is shaped by her role as a founder, investor, and advocate for science-driven philanthropy rather than by any single corporate or political role.
